Hello everyone

Im just wondering if someone has a a take on Dodges and criticals vs and with spells.

For Example Poppy's Devastating Blow can not crit and can not be dodged?

Olaf's Reckless Swing, can it critical? I think so and if it can critical, can it also be dodged. If it critical hits, would Olaf do double damage to himself?

Heimerdinger's Rockets?

Teemo;s Blind?

etc.

Is there a rule of thumb for which spells can deliver critical damage and which spells can and can not be dodged or some place where this is discussed in greater detail?

I dont think abilities can crit unless absolutely stated - like parlay 'applies onhit effects and can crit'.

effects that are modifications to the next autoattack (shens passive, akali's q proc) can be dodged.

Ive dodged parlay before, for example, but never a rocket or teemos blind

Modified auto-attacks can crit, such as Poppy's Q, or Nasus' Q - however the bonus damage doesn't crit, the auto-attack does, and then the bonus damage from the ability is added on top, if I'm not mistaken.

Olaf's Reckless Swing is not a modified auto-attack, it is a separate ability all to its self. Heimer's Rockets, Teemo's blind - these are all abilities and not modified auto-attacks.

The only abilities that can be dodged are skillshots, and those require you to actively move out of the way. Because of this, dodge is only a counter to physical DPS champions, though by a great amount. With full dodge yellows you can get about 7% dodge, which is like 7% reduction in damage from any physical source, and it stacks with armor.

If you're talking about the "Dodge" stat, abilities cannot be dodged. Some abilities that modify autoattacks can be dodged, but for the most part those have all gotten buffed so they cannot be dodged.You can't dodge any ability that isn't a modified autoattack.

As for Crit, any ability that modifies an autoattack can crit, but it only increases the attack damage. The bonus damage does not crit, it's just added on top of the critical. The only non-autoattack abilities that can crit are Parrrley and Judgement. And on Judgement, it's only the damage from his attack damage, not the base ability damage, that can crit. No other ability can crit or be dodged, even those that look like they are made with the champion's weapon like Reckless Swing and Blinding Dark.
